It is not easy to recognize all his tattoos. Some of them are quite big, others are not clear enough to tell what they really are. This is what I was able to find out about Shaquille’s tattoos:

Shaq is one of many NBA players who decided to have his own nickname etched into his skin. Shaq chose Diesel, among his many pseudonyms, as the tattoo for his left shoulder. He got it right on top of his favorite tattoo, perennial hallmark of his immortal ego: the big “S” for Superman. Still not satisfied, he has also added the inscription “Man of Steel” to it.

Harder to make out are the tattoo designs on Shaq’s right shoulder and arm. One of them should show the name of his daughter Amirah, but I can’t say for sure.

Two more controversial inscriptions say: “The world is mine” and “Against the law” because, as Shaq explains, “My game is so good there has to be a law to stop it.”

Another interesting tattoo design on his right arm depicts a fist holding a diamond.

Some other recognizable tattoos on Shaq’s body are the word “BIG” and the Hulk-esque design of a huge, muscular man, perhaps representing Shaquille himself, on his right forearm.
